Tezak Heavy Equipment Co., Inc. is a well-established family owned and operated construction company. Tezak Heavy Equipment Co., Inc. is building and expanding for the future and is poised on the leading edge of growth in the industry and in Colorado. Located in Southern Colorado, in what is affectionately called the “banana belt of Colorado”, we offer a warm community for you and your family, easy commutes to larger cities, and a lower cost of living.
The majority of work we contract is as prime on highway projects, but our full offering of services include: Excavation, Clearing and Grubbing, Grading, Blasting, Channel Stabilization, Utilities, Overlot Grading, Pipe Installation, Stormwater Sewer, Aggregate Rock Quarry, Heavy/Highway Road Construction, Erosion Control, Dams.
Our main location boasts our corporate office, maintenance shop, Cañon City quarry and scale house. We also offer aggregate to local landscapers, government contracts and construction companies. Estimator I is responsible for calculating and preparing work item quantities and production comparison reports for bid items for potential work and/or existing projects. They will review project plans and specifications to determine the overall scope-of-work for a project. Assists the Senior Estimator in various stages of the project estimate, material procurement and subcontractor quotes. Work with project team on project design, production analysis, quantities and topo’s to verify construction work is being built as per plan and specifications. Must make independent decisions that may directly impact the success/failure of a project.
Driver will haul rock products, to include: fine and coarse aggregate, riprap and boulders; to and from job sites for both internal and customer projects. Will drive on local streets and roads, as well as state and interstate highways and may upon occasion haul heavy, oversized or overweight loads.
Field Engineer is responsible for all engineering and technical disciplines associated with assigned projects. The Field Engineer will schedule, plan, forecast, resource and manage all technical activities to ensure project accuracy, timeliness, quality and costs.
The CAD Technician is responsible for generating surface and solid CAD models for our projects. This position will require meeting with engineers, project managers, field leadership and other support staff to develop accurate blueprints and design plans by using CAD software. As a successful CAD technician, you should have experience working with CAD software, attention for detail, and ability to work independently or as part of a team.
